Jersey Tiger Moth

Description:

Near black upper wings with straight white lies. Dark orange under wing with black spots. Light orange underside. About 30 mm long.

Habitat:

Fed for over 30 minutes on the flowers of a mint plant in my south facing back garden

Notes:

Unusual wing shape with a body more like a butterfly.
